GUSH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2020 in Review
36 of the 5,652 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Direxion Daily S&P Oil & Gas Exp. & Prod. Bull 2X ETF (GUSH) for Q4 2020, worth a combined $32.4M — up 139% from $13.6M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 10 funds opened new GUSH positions and 8 closed out — a net gain of 2 holders — while 10 added to existing stakes and 8 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Impala Asset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$3.8M. The largest seller was HRT Financial, cutting an estimated $2.31M.
